I visited 4 different pet stores in the atlanta area to gather all but about 20lbs of my rock (which I ordered from a diver...it's due here thursday).
The places I went to (in no particular order):
Aquarium Showcase - Alpharetta - not much in the way of live rock, but good knowledgable staff, more saltwater then anything - prices are high

Optimum Aquarium - Marietta (more northside) - Fiji, Tonga (chunks) and baserock - large(ish) selection of cured bulk rock - equal (and large) selection of salt/fresh water specimens - fair(ish) prices - only place I have found with macro algae for sale - expired test kits :/

Marine Reef and Fish Supplies (aka Marine and Tropical Fish) - Marietta (closer to town) - Nice selection of carribean rock with decent life (some macro algae and tube worms and such) as well as a good assortment of marshall and carribean rock fragments - more freshwater stock (fish) then salt but good selection anyhow - new frag tank (looks nice) - fair(ish) prices

The Fish Store and More - Peachtree rd in Buckhead - nice store - decent selection of fiji and a few lively tonga branch fragments - marine fish looked washed out somewhat (color loss) but the FW looked very healthy - more marine then fresh but a good selection all around.

Imagine Ocean - Really didn't care for this one..in canton.. Nice display tank, nice water distrib system in the place.. prices too high and lack of selection/poor looking specimens
